DRI ranges help a person to simply estimate the utmost variety that an item is often both detected, recognized or discovered. It is crucial to note that these estimates are based entirely on geometrical parameters – the goal sizing, distance, lens focal length and camera detector pixel size. Signal amount, detector sensitivity, atmospheric conditions and various aspects are not regarded!

This new lens assembly integrates LightPath's Black Diamond™ molded chalcogenide infrared lenses which have been a lessen Price tag substitute for high quantity diamond-turned Germanium and Zinc Selenide optics. The opto-mechanical style and design coupled with the exclusive substance properties of Black Diamond Eyeglasses give athermalization for temperature steadiness from -40°C to 85°C without the need of including supplemental Price.
